#include<iostream>
#include<string>
using namespace std;
string suanshi,suanshi2;
char d;
string yiwei(int a,char c,string n)//a为位置,c为插入字符串,n被插入
{
string x;
for(int i=0;i<=a;i++)
{
x[i]=n[i];
}
x[a+1]=c;
for(int i=a+1;i<=n.size()-1;i++)
{
x[i+1]=n[i];
}
return x;
/****************未完成****************/
}
int Find(char ch,string b)
{
for (int i = 0; i < b.size();i++)
{
if (b[i] == ch)
{
return i;
}
}
return -1;
}
void out(string aa)
{
for(int i=0;i<=aa.size()-1;i++)
{
cout<<aa[i];
}
}
/*int main()
{
cin>>suanshi;
suanshi2=suanshi;
int na=0;
string m;
cin>>na>>m;
yiwei(na,m);
}*/
int main()
{
cin>>suanshi;
suanshi2=suanshi;
cout<<Find('=',suanshi)<<endl;
d='+';
out(suanshi2);
out(yiwei(Find('=',suanshi),'+',suanshi2));
}//*/
假设输入123=123那么希望输出123=+123